Before its introduction, some speculated that it would replace Diet Mountain Dew as the new low-sugar drink. ![]() In January 2020, Mountain Dew Zero Sugar was released in the United States. The previous formulation was sweetened exclusively with aspartame. In 2006, Diet Mountain Dew received a formula change by PepsiCo created a new and improved formula called a "Tuned Up Taste." This "Tuned Up Taste" uses a blend of sweeteners named sucralose, aspartame, and acesulfame potassium. Its tagline is "Low Calorie DEW." Historyĭiet Mountain Dew was first introduced in 1984, used to be branded as Sugar-Free Mountain Dew when it was renamed to Diet Mountain Dew, its current name. Diet Mountain Dew is a modified version of the Original formula, containing low sugar count but retaining the same citrus taste and yellow-green color as the Original Mountain Dew drink, similar to, but a separate drink from, Mountain Dew Zero Sugar.
